I've seen complete GT take-off suspension componant sets on e-bay. Springs, shocks, swaybars, the works. Will this set bolt up to the V-6? Has any one here done this swap?
Yes, I have and its a simple bolt on .... forget the shocks and springs though, the V6 has the same ones. (do a search for Swaybar here)
I also recommend adding the Roush lowering springs (rear only). Its an easy mod with great results. If you've got deep pockets get the Tokiko D-Specs shocks as Jimp has already recommended. Great stuff
A strut tower brace is an easy install as well.
& BTW / I have a pair of the FORD shackle bolts that you'll need for the swaybar install - for some dumb reason Ford only sells them is sets of four > <
